The length of the rectangle is 2 times its width. Find the sides of the rectangle if it is 50 cm longer than its width.

| Let’s take the width of the rectangle as X, then its length is 2X, since it is 2 times the width. It is known that the length is 50 cm more than the width, we will compose and solve the equation:
2X – X = 50;
X = 50 (cm) – the width of the rectangle.
2 * X = 2 * 50 = 100 (cm) – the length of the rectangle.
Let’s check the solution of the equation:
2 * 50 – 50 = 50;
50 = 50.
Answer: 50 cm width of the rectangle, 100 cm length of the rectangle.
